Glutathione
Also referred to as: GSH
Overview
Glutathione is a small peptide that participates in cellular redox balance and the processing of certain reactive compounds. It has been investigated in relation to oxidative stress, hepatic function, and immune activity, but its established biological roles do not by themselves demonstrate benefits from supplementation.
Biological background
Glutathione contains glutamate, cysteine, and glycine; the notes incorrectly identify glutamine as a constituent. It is synthesized in many tissues, including the liver, and exists in reduced and oxidized forms that participate in cellular redox processes.
Mechanism
Glutathione-dependent enzyme systems help process peroxides and conjugate certain electrophilic substances, linking glutathione to antioxidant defenses and chemical metabolism. Research also examines how glutathione availability and redox balance influence immune-cell function, rather than assuming a general enhancement of immunity.

What the source states
The source guide presents glutathione as an internally produced antioxidant associated with cellular maintenance, liver function, and immune responses. It suggests that supplementation can strengthen these functions, but the supplied excerpt provides no study-level evidence supporting that inference. The guide also characterizes tolerability favorably while mentioning possible digestive symptoms.

What remains uncertain
The supplied material does not establish whether supplementation produces meaningful clinical outcomes or identify which populations might benefit. Broad references to detoxification and immune enhancement lack clearly defined endpoints.
Safety information
Safety data are limited in the supplied material, and its general reassurance should not be interpreted as evidence of safety across populations or products. Digestive symptoms are mentioned, but their frequency and clinical significance are not documented. This information is not medical advice.
